While the River School Farm is not exactly in Lake Tahoe, the farm is located right on the Truckee River in Verdi and is about a half-hour drive from North Lake Tahoe or the town of Truckee. The River School Farm has become a popular place for both locals and visitors wanting to understand more about the land and how our food is grown. The River School has several greenhouses and hoop houses overflowing with vegetables, several pens for goats, ducks and chickens and even an apiary buzzing with honeybees. The natural lush gardens, full of native plants and trees, are also dotted with sculptures and art from local artists.

The River School Farm also offers workshops ranging from drum circles to children's cooking classes and gardening to belly dancing. Their other classes and workshops teach everything from how to raise bees and harvest honey to how to grow food in the high desert and in small spaces. Their Dynamic Vinyasa yoga classes are taught by the lovely Jelena Hardy and either take place in the yoga studio or outside on the lawn. The classes are from 5:00-6:30 pm on Tuesdays and Thursdays and from 9:00-10:15 am on Sundays.

The River School Farm also offers native landscaping services and a local CSA. The farm is even available to rent for special events and parties. If you are looking for a unique and beautiful place to have a wedding, the River School has an outdoor kitchen for food prep, a large grassy area by the river for the ceremony and reception, and a ton of little nooks and crannies around the yard for guests to enjoy the river and views of the mountains.
